On March 18, 2025, Nvidia's CEO, Jensen Huang, took the stage at the annual GPU Technology Conference (GTC) to share groundbreaking innovations, including the Blackwell Ultra AI chip and the next-generation Vera Rubin platform. Unpacking the Blackwell Ultra AI Chip

Nvidia's newest offering, the Blackwell Ultra AI chip, is a significant enhancement over its predecessor, aimed at facilitating complex operations more efficiently. Huang described the chip as an integral component poised to redefine enterprise AI applications.

Key Features of the Blackwell Ultra AI Chip:

  • Increased Performance: The new chip promises higher processing speeds, enabling faster computations essential for applications such as machine learning and data processing.
  • Energy Efficiency: As green computing becomes a priority, Blackwell Ultra is designed to deliver superior performance without exerting substantial energy demands.
  • Advanced Integrations: The chip seamlessly integrates with existing Nvidia architectures, allowing businesses to leverage new technologies alongside their current systems, thereby reducing the cost of upgrading.

Huang's strategic presentation highlighted how the Blackwell Ultra could serve as a boon for enterprises looking to harness AI's full power, mimicking the iPhone's adoption curve where improved technology drives widespread utilization.

Market Response and Analyst Perspectives

Following Huang’s keynote, responses from financial analysts highlight a robust optimism surrounding Nvidia's trajectory. Jefferies and Bank of America analysts expressed in their reports that these advancements could ignite investor enthusiasm as Nvidia navigates past recent supply chain issues.

Analyst Insights:

  • Jefferies Financial Group emphasized that the announcements at GTC could act as positive catalysts for Nvidia's market performance, suggesting that they could spark renewed investor confidence.
  • Bank of America noted that while updates on the Blackwell Ultra are anticipated, they also expect groundbreaking insights into Nvidia's future in autonomous driving and quantum computing—areas ripe for substantial growth.

The analysis underscores the broader market anticipation for Nvidia, particularly given its strategic direction towards more comprehensive hardware solutions and the cultivation of a sustainable AI ecosystem.

The Introduction of Project DIGITS

Amidst the buzz around the Blackwell Ultra and Vera Rubin, Huang also introduced Project DIGITS, a personal AI supercomputer developed for smaller enterprises and individual developers. This initiative represents a pivotal step in democratizing access to state-of-the-art AI technology.

Implications for Developers:

  • Accessibility: With a price point under 5% of the latest Blackwell GPUs, DIGITS makes advanced AI tools accessible to startups and independent developers.
  • Empowerment: This initiative allows developers to easily create and implement their own AI models, fostering innovation at grassroots levels within the tech community.

Kevin Cook, senior stock strategist at Zacks Investment Research, remarked that Nvidia could be experiencing an "Apple moment," where a pivotal product changes the landscape of consumer technology. The broad adoption of the DIGITS could lead to a new wave of AI applications created by smaller players not previously able to access advanced computational resources.
